To variety the briquettes, to start with, cut the top quarter off a two-liter soda bottle. Punch drainage holes in The underside, then insert a plastic bag to work as a liner. Scoop the combination to the plastic bag until eventually it’s whole, then, make use of a can to thrust it to the bottle and squeeze out extra drinking water. Take the briquette out and Enable it dry for three-7 days prior to burning it. To learn about other materials you can use to make briquettes, Please read on!
